Raffaele Marciello gets best time in first free practice session

Raffaele Marciello (27/I) of Mann-Filter Team Landgraf set the first time to beat at the fourth event of the ADAC GT Masters season at the Nürburgring. The recent winner of the 24-hour race at Spa-Francorchamps drove the fastest lap in the first free practice session, with a time of 1:26.455 minutes, and celebrated a good start in the Eifel region with his new team-mate Maro Engel (36/Monte Carlo) in the Mercedes-AMG GT3 #48.

Behind them, Ayhancan Güven (24/TR) and Christian Engelhart (35/Starnberg) in the Porsche 911 GT3 R #91, trailing by 0.347 seconds, were the only other pairing to stay under the 1:27.000-minute mark. Third place in the first session went to Maximilian Paul (22/Dresden) and Marco Mapelli (35/I) of Paul Motorsport in the Lamborghini Huracán GT3 Evo with car number 71. The Jan Marschalkowski (19/Inning) and Luca Stolz (27/Brachbach) duo of Mercedes-AMG Team ZVO steered the Mercedes-AMG GT3 Evo #8 into fourth place, and in fifth place was the combination Elias Seppänen (18/FIN) and Frank Bird (22/GB) in the Mercedes-AMG GT3 Evo with car number 84, of Mann-Filter Team Landgraf.

In cool temperatures of 17 degrees and on a wet track, many teams started out cautiously on Friday morning, first testing the track conditions with rain tyres. After several laps, the slicks came out and the lap times on the 3.629-kilometre track got better and better. A good seven minutes before the end, Raffaele Marciello ousted Christian Engelhart, who was in front of him, from first place, and clinched the first best time of the fourth stop on the German GT Championship tour at the Nürburgring.
